Dwele

Dwele is an R&B artist and a songwriter. is debut album Subject was released in 2003 and his second album Some Kinda in 2005.

[edit] Early Life

RnB singer Dwele (Andwele Gardner) came from Detroit Michigan. At the age of 10 years old, Dwele started writing songs. He grew up listening to Marvin Gaye and Stevie Wonder. Dwele studied music for a year. In 1998, a demo tape called The Rize was a hit on the radio. He started spending his time working with Slum Village and rapper Bahamadia.

[edit] Early Career

Dwele signed in with Virgin Records and released his debut album, Subject, in 2003. He won majority of the European audiences. It was followed by an extensive tour. In 2005, his sophomore album, Some Kinda, came out.

[edit] Chart Toppers

Year Title Hot R&B/Hip-Hop Singles & Tracks Billboard Hot 100 Album
2003 Find A Way 42 93 Subject
2004 Hold On 53 Subject
2005 I Think I Love U 53 Some Kinda...
